Splitceipt's answer:
Friends, couples, roommates, travelers, and groups who regularly share expenses. It's especially useful for restaurant bills, trips, shared households, and situations where people didn't all spend the same amount and want a fairer way to work out who owes what.
Splitceipt's answer:
Most expense apps work well for simple group balances but become tedious when the real bill is more complicated. Splitceipt handles both: quick everyday splits when simplicity is enough, and detailed itemized splitting when accuracy matters. Receipt scanning reduces manual entry, groups keep ongoing expenses organized, and guest links mean your friends don't have to install another app just because you use Splitceipt.
Splitceipt's answer:
Splitceipt combines flexible expense splitting with receipt scanning and frictionless sharing. Expenses can be split equally, by percentage, custom amounts, or item by item from a scanned receipt. Best of all, not everyone needs the app - guests can open a shared link, see what they owe, and mark themselves paid without creating an account.
Splitceipt's answer:
Splitceipt came from a simple problem: real-world expenses rarely split as neatly as a total divided by the number of people.
Sometimes everyone owes the same amount. Sometimes each person ordered different things. Sometimes costs are shared in completely different proportions. Existing workflows often make the simple cases easy or the complicated cases possible — but not both.
Splitceipt was built to make the method fit the expense, instead of forcing every expense into the same type of split.
Splitceipt's answer:
React Native, Expo, Node.js, Express, PostgreSQL, Neon, and Google Gemini for receipt scanning and extraction.
